Ap—0 to 23 centimeters (0.0 to 9.1 inches); very dark grayish brown (10YR 3/2) Error; moderate medium and coarse granular structure; friable; 1 percent fine prominent yellowish red (5YR 5/8), moist, masses of oxidized iron; fragments; abrupt sm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011204
Bg11—23 to 30 centimeters (9.1 to 11.8 inches); yellowish brown (10YR 5/6) Error; moderate medium subangular blocky structure; firm; 33 percent medium prominent strong brown (7.5YR 5/8), moist, masses of oxidized iron; fragments; clear sm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011205
Bg12—30 to 39 centimeters (11.8 to 15.4 inches); reddish yellow (7.5YR 6/8) Error; moderate fine and medium prismatic, and moderate subangular blocky structure; firm; 1 percent fine faint light yellowish brown (10YR 6/4), moist, masses of reduced iron; fragments; clear wavy bo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011206
Bg21—39 to 58 centimeters (15.4 to 22.8 inches); reddish yellow (7.5YR 6/8) Error; strong medium and coarse prismatic, and moderate subangular blocky structure; firm; 1 percent medium faint light yellowish brown (10YR 6/4), moist, masses of reduced iron; fragments; gradual wavy bo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011207
Bg22—58 to 94 centimeters (22.8 to 37.0 inches); strong brown (7.5YR 5/8) Error; moderate medium and coarse prismatic, and weak subangular blocky structure; firm; 1 percent medium faint yellowish brown (10YR 5/6), moist, masses of reduced iron; fragments; gradual sm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011209
Bgx22—58 to 94 centimeters (22.8 to 37.0 inches); strong brown (7.5YR 5/8) Error; massive; very firm; 1 percent medium faint yellowish brown (10YR 5/6), moist, masses of reduced iron and 33 percent black (10YR 2/1), moist, iron-manganese concretions; fragments. Lab sample # OSU0011208. Very weakly developed, discontinuous fragipan.
B23—94 to 122 centimeters (37.0 to 48.0 inches); yellowish red (5YR 5/8) Error; weak coarse prismatic structure; firm; 11 percent medium faint yellowish brown (10YR 5/6), moist, masses of reduced iron; fragments; gradual wavy bo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011210
B3—122 to 142 centimeters (48.0 to 55.9 inches); yellowish brown (10YR 5/6) Error; massive; friable; strong brown (7.5YR 5/8), moist, masses of oxidized iron and 11 percent medium distinct gray (N 6/), moist, masses of reduced iron; fragments; clear smooth boundary. Lab sample # OSU0011211
142 to 168 centimeters (55.9 to 66.1 inches); grayish brown (2.5Y 5/2) and yellowish brown (10YR 5/6) Error; fragments. Lab sample # OSU0011212
